Create watcher alarm using Rotator telemetry to track high amplitude vibrations in phase 1

Description

This action item is in response to the analysis associated with vibrations on the Top-End Assembly (TEA).
We need to implement a Watcher alarm to detect high amplitude vibrations on the TEA before leaving the rotator on for tests, as we did before. We want this alarm to monitor the Rotator telemetry for this particular ticket.

We still need to define exactly what would be the threshold to trigger the alarm.
This might require further data analysis (https://rubinobs.atlassian.net/browse/SITCOM-1285#icft=SITCOM-1285).

Use https://ts-watcher.lsst.io/ to implement a new watcher.

To differentiate the frequencies of 0.12 Hz and 0.65 Hz while the rotator is stalled, if the sampling frequency is 20 Hz (CSC level), the number of sampling point to FFT should be >= 1024. If the sampling frequency is 2000 Hz (low-level controller level), the number of sampling points to FFT should be >= 32768.
